Subject: Sample Shipment — Partner Lab Run

Dispatch team, please schedule tomorrow's run carrying twelve refrigerated sample tubes from our Norwick site to the Ashvale Diagnostics lab. The cold-chain box must stay upright and the temperature logger must remain active throughout. Driver should verify the seal numbers against the manifest at both ends and obtain a signature on receipt. The confidential instruction covering the courier hand-over is appended directly below this message.

dispatch memo: the sorox briiel courier leaves the druius kelion fenir gorvan ralael rusius julwyn belwyn ledger at gate 4220 under passcode 637242

Document Transport — Recalled Charger Pallet

Quick one for dispatch: the pallet of recalled Voltbrim chargers is shrink-wrapped and tagged in bay 6, heading back to the Grayvale returns hub. Don't break the wrap and don't mix it with outbound stock — recall items travel alone. When the courier shows up, do the hand-over per the confidential instruction below.

dispatch memo: the eliok quenok courier leaves the sorael aldath belion tammir casix gileth queniel jorath ledger at gate 9299 under passcode 897989

## Build Provenance — Pebbleware Component Library

Pebbleware is the shared component library used by all Quillfront product teams. Every published version carries a provenance record linking the artifact to the exact commit, the build runner image, and the signing step. New team members: never consume a Pebbleware version lacking this record, and never republish artifacts by hand. Version bumps follow strict semver, enforced in CI. The identifier for the current signed release follows.

pipeline stamp: htk3_69f